Watch English television with subtitles. You can get better at spelling without even realising it by learning while you’re watching television in English. Simply switch the subtitles on and you’ll see how the words you’re hearing should be spelled.

The similar-sounding noun “ aisle ” gets its roots from an Old French word “ele” from the 14 th century. Back then, it meant “wing” or “side.”. The Old French term evolved from the Latin word “ala,” which also means “wing.”. Eventually, it turned into “aisle” and came to mean “area alongside or through,” which is ...

The verb spell commonly means to write or name the letters making up a word in the right order. Spell is a verb with irregular and regular forms. Spelled and spelt are both common forms of the past tense and the past participle of spell, though with geographical differences. Spelling games online.
